Understanding the CNC Tool & Cutter Grinding Machine Market
The CNC Tool & Cutter Grinding Machine market is witnessing remarkable growth, with its size estimated at USD 3.96 Billion in 2023 and projected to soar to USD 5.42 Billion by 2032. This growth reflects a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.54% across the forecast period from 2024 to 2032. The skyrocketing demand for high-quality and high-performance grinding tools, particularly from sectors such as automotive and aerospace, significantly influences market expansion. In this context, companies are increasingly investing in automation technologies to boost production efficiency and deliver cost-effective solutions.

Market Dynamics and Key Drivers
The growing emphasis on precision engineering in sectors such as automotive, aerospace, and electrical manufacturing is pushing the demand for CNC grinding technologies. These grinders provide the accuracy and performance needed for creating high-tolerance components. As manufacturers strive for enhanced efficiency and automated processes, CNC technology becomes indispensable in achieving these goals.
Market Segmentation by Type and Application
By type, the Universal Grinding Machines segment has emerged as the predominant category in the CNC Tool & Cutter Grinding Machine market, capturing more than 48% market share. Their versatility allows them to adapt to various grinding tasks, including surface, cylindrical, and internal grinding processes, making them essential in manufacturing environments.
Application Insights
The automotive industry represents a significant portion of the market, holding over 44% share currently. With the system's precision, CNC grinding machines play a pivotal role in ensuring the accuracy of critical components such as engine parts and transmission systems. As innovations continue in the automotive sector, especially focused on performance enhancement, the relevance of CNC tool grinding will only increase.
Regional Market Analysis
North America and Asia-Pacific are leading the global CNC Tool & Cutter Grinding Machine market. North America, thanks to its established manufacturing infrastructure and the presence of major CNC machine producers, accounted for over 38% of the market in 2023. The region's commitment to advancements in precision tools, alongside significant investments in research and development, further solidify its prominent position.
Asia-Pacific Growth Trajectory
Meanwhile, the Asia-Pacific region is recognized as the fastest-growing market due to rapid industrialization in countries like China, Japan, and India. There's a pressing need to satisfy the industrial demands for automation within this region. The adoption of Industry 4.0 principles aids in improving manufacturing capabilities, thus escalating the demand for CNC Tool & Cutter Grinding Machines.
Recent Developments in CNC Tool Grinding Technology
Recent innovations brewed by notable players in the market have led to significant developments. For instance, in early 2023, Makino launched a cutting-edge CNC tool-grinding machine with advanced automation capabilities, aimed at enhancing accuracy and performance while lowering operational costs.
